630

630 = 2 x 32 x 5 x 7.

630 is a triangular number. It is the sum of the first 35 integers: 1 + 2 + 3 + . . . + 34 + 35 = 630. 630 is also three times a triangular number (210) and six times a triangular number (105).

630 is 21312 in base 4.

630 is the sum of six consecutive primes: 97 + 101 + 103 + 107 + 109 + 113 = 630.


630 is the height and the span (in feet) of the stainless steel arch “Gateway to the West” in St. Louis, Missouri.
